Transaction 054ad3256967cd99953a72ca31100cd34e955cfc50906c2a9f8a90e7baeaaa5e
1 Input
2 Outputs
- 054ad3256967cd99953a72ca31100cd34e955cfc50906c2a9f8a90e7baeaaa5e:0
- 054ad3256967cd99953a72ca31100cd34e955cfc50906c2a9f8a90e7baeaaa5e:1
value 1253404
address 1MWeWGtubKzGcz78pgYiZvAhXRNaSA1ytQ
value 69599370
address 1EyfishSupikU25TQebWVF6vjnHENpBdQG